Engine Overview
The B3154T is a compact yet powerful 1.5-liter turbocharged inline-four engine developed by Volvo. This engine is part of Volvo’s Drive-E engine family, which emphasizes efficiency, performance, and low emissions. With its turbocharging technology, the B3154T manages to deliver impressive power outputs while maintaining a relatively small displacement. This makes it an ideal choice for modern vehicles that require both agility and fuel efficiency.
Designed with a focus on sustainability, the B3154T engine reflects Volvo’s commitment to reducing environmental impact. The turbocharger enhances the engine’s performance without necessitating a larger displacement, allowing for better fuel economy and lower CO2 emissions. This engine is equipped with advanced features such as direct fuel injection and variable valve timing, which contribute to its performance and efficiency.
The B3154T engine is characterized by its smooth power delivery and responsiveness, making it suitable for various driving conditions. Whether you’re navigating city streets or cruising on the highway, this engine provides a balanced driving experience, combining power with efficiency. Its compact size also allows for versatile packaging within the engine bay, contributing to overall vehicle design flexibility.

Specifications
The B3154T engine is a finely-tuned piece of engineering that combines advanced technology with practical performance. Below, you will find detailed specifications that highlight the engine’s capabilities, performance metrics, and maintenance requirements.
Engine Specifications
Specification | Details |
---|---|
Engine Type | Inline-4, Turbocharged |
Displacement | 1.5 L (1500 cc) |
Max Power Output | 152 hp (113 kW) at 5,000 rpm |
Max Torque | 250 Nm (184 lb-ft) at 1,500-3,500 rpm |
Compression Ratio | 10.3:1 |
Fuel System | Direct Fuel Injection |
Turbocharger | Single Twin-scroll Turbo |
Fuel Type | Petrol (Gasoline) |
Emissions Standard | Euro 6 |
Performance Metrics
The B3154T engine is engineered for optimal performance, balancing power and efficiency. Here are some key performance metrics:
Metric | Value |
---|---|
0-100 km/h (0-62 mph) | Approximately 8.5 seconds |
Top Speed | 210 km/h (130 mph) |
Fuel Economy (Combined) | 5.5 L/100 km (42.8 mpg) |
CO2 Emissions | 126 g/km |
Oil Capacity and Recommendations
Proper maintenance is crucial for the longevity and efficiency of the B3154T engine. Below are the oil capacity and recommendations:
Specification | Details |
---|---|
Oil Capacity (with filter) | 4.5 liters |
Oil Type | Fully Synthetic 0W-30 or 5W-30 |
Oil Change Interval | 15,000 km (9,300 miles) or 12 months |

Common Problems and Reliability
The B3154T engine, while generally regarded as a reliable powertrain, is not without its share of common issues. Understanding these problems can help owners and potential buyers make informed decisions regarding maintenance and care.
Typical Issues Encountered
While the B3154T is engineered with durability in mind, some users have reported specific problems that can arise over time. Here are the most frequently noted issues:
- Oil Leaks: Over time, seals and gaskets may wear out, leading to oil leaks. Regular inspections can help catch these leaks early.
- Turbocharger Failures: Some owners have experienced issues with the turbocharger, including wastegate malfunctions or bearing failures. These problems can lead to reduced performance and increased exhaust smoke.
- Fuel Injector Problems: Clogged or malfunctioning fuel injectors can cause rough idling, poor acceleration, and reduced fuel efficiency. Regular cleaning can mitigate this issue.
- Timing Belt Wear: The timing belt should be replaced at recommended intervals. Failure to do so can lead to catastrophic engine damage if the belt breaks.
- Electrical Issues: Some users report intermittent electrical problems, particularly with sensors. These can lead to check engine lights and performance issues.
